What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Manage Employer Refund email box
  • Submit manual refund requests for approval in accordance with signature authority guidelines
  • Conduct daily audits of automated refunds
  •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to gather required documentation for processing refunds
  • Assist Accounts Receivable departments with tasks and inquiries as required
  • Represent the agency in Liquor Commission hearings when required

Qualifications

42 mos. exp. or 42 mos. trg. in accounting &/or finance to include an advanced level of experience in spreadsheet software.



  • Or completion of undergraduate core program in business administration, accounting, finance or related field; 18 mos. exp. or 18 mos. trg. in accounting &/or finance to include an advanced level of experience in spreadsheet software.

  • Or completion of graduate core program in business administration, accounting, finance or related field; 6 mos. exp. or 6 mos. trg. in accounting &/or finance to include an advanced level of experience in spreadsheet software.

  • Or 12 mos. exp. as Financial Analyst, 66562.

  • Or equivalent of Minimum Class Qualifications for Employment noted above. NOTE: Successful completion of the Fiscal Academy may be substituted for 4 mos. of required accounting/fiscal experience referenced in this portion of the minimum qualifications.

Job Skills: Accounting and Finance

Major Worker Characteristics:

Knowledge of BWC, Division & department policies & standard operating procedures*; accounting; applicable state &/or federal laws, rules, procedures & standards governing fiscal operations*; employee training & development*.

Skill in use of calculator; electronic devices (e.g. computer, tablets, cell phones) & applicable software applications (e.g. spreadsheets, databases, word processing); multi-purpose work centers; reporting*; CoreSuite*; Rates & Payments system*; Oracle systems*.

Ability to define problems, collect & analyze data, establish facts & draw valid conclusions; gather, collate & classify information about data, people or things; deal with many variables & determine specific action; collaborate with co-workers on group projects; respond to confidential & sensitive inquiries from employees, public & government officials.

Salary Information:
Hourly wage is expected to be paid at step 1 of the pay range associated with the position for candidates who are new employees of the state. Current employees of the state will be placed in the appropriate step based on any applicable union contract and/or requirements of the Ohio Revised Code. Movement to the next step of the pay range (a roughly 4% increase) will occur after six months, assuming job performance is acceptable. Thereafter, an employee will advance one step in the pay range every year until the highest step of the pay range is reached.
